Laminate Floor Water Extraction Cost in Blue Mound, TX

The cost of laminate floor water extraction can vary dep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ions. Here are some estimated costs to expect:

Service Typical Price Range What Affects Cost
Water extraction $500 – $2,500 Severity of damage, size of affected area, and local conditions
Drying and dehumidification $200 – $1,000 Size of affected area, number of equipment needed, and local conditions
Inspection and testing $100 – $500 Size of affected area, number of equipment needed, and local conditions
Repair and replacement $500 – $5,000 Severity of damage, size of affected area, and local conditions
Emergency service fee $100 – $500 Time of day, day of week, and local conditions

Common Questions About Laminate Floor Water Extraction

Q: How long does laminate floor water extraction take?

A: The time it takes to extract water from your laminate floor depends on the severity of the damage and the size of the affected area. Our team will work efficiently to reduce downtime and get your floor back to normal. Extraction times can range from 1-5 days, depending on the situation.
